What is python3-django-sass

python3-django-sass is:

The module is the absolute simplest way to use Sass with Django. Pure Python, minimal dependencies, and no special configuration required. django-sass only depends on libsass.

Other packages such as django-libsass and django-sass-processor, while nice packages, require django-compressor which itself depends on several other packages that require compilation to install.

  • If you simply want to use Sass in development without installing a web of unwanted dependencies, then django-sass is for you.
  • If you don’t want to deploy any processors or compressors to your production server, then django-sass is for you.
  • If you don’t want to change the way you reference and serve static files, then django-sass is for you.
  • And if you want the absolute simplest installation and setup possible for doing Sass, django-sass is for you too.

There are three methods to install python3-django-sass on Debian 12.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.

Install python3-django-sass Using apt-get

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.

sudo apt-get update

After updating apt database, We can install python3-django-sass using apt-get by running the following command:

sudo apt-get -y install python3-django-sass

How To Uninstall python3-django-sass on Debian 12

To uninstall only the python3-django-sass package we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get remove python3-django-sass

Uninstall python3-django-sass And Its Dependencies

To uninstall python3-django-sass and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Debian 12, we can use the command below: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ove python3-django-sass

Remove python3-django-sass Configurations and Data

To remove python3-django-sass configuration and data from Debian 12 we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y purge python3-django-sass

Remove python3-django-sass configuration, data, and all of its dependencies

We can use the following command to remove python3-django-sass config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ge python3-django-sass
